Boxes of oranges being stowed in No. 5 hold on board the refrigerated cargo ship Maranga (1972) while alongside a quay at Brownsville, Texas. The photographer is standing on the upper deck looking down at the open hatch to No. 5 Hold. Boxes of oranges already stowed in the hold line the background of the image. A wooden pallet with boxes of oranges is set in the middle ground in front of the stowed boxes. Four large sheets of wood partially cover the floor of the hold. A pile of boxes of oranges is in the foreground on the right hand side. This is Slide 21 of a lecture given by Captain Henry P. Bird detailing his service as Second Officer and later temporary Chief Officer on board the refrigerated cargo ship Maranga (1972) owned by Island Fruit Reefers Ltd and on charter to Salenrederierna from 28 September 1974 to 15 November 1974. The lecture consists of 23 slides.
